FAQ
Q: How should I clean and care for Stoneware Tableware to keep it in the best condition? A: Stoneware Tableware should be cleaned after each use with warm soapy water. While many pieces are dishwasher safe, handwashing is recommended to maintain their appearance for longer. Avoid sudden temperature changes, such as placing hot items on cold surfaces, as this can cause cracking. Q: Can Stoneware Tableware be safely cleaned in the dishwasher? A: Yes, most Stoneware Tableware can be cleaned in the dishwasher. However, it's best to refer to the care instructions provided by the manufacturer to ensure that specific items are dishwasher safe and won't get damaged over time. Q: Does Stoneware Tableware stain easily, especially with acidic foods? A: Stoneware Tableware is generally resistant to staining, but certain acidic foods like tomato sauce or wine can leave marks if left on the surface for too long. It's advisable to clean your tableware promptly after use to avoid any potential stains. Q: Is there any specific way to handle Stoneware Tableware to prevent chipping? A: To prevent chipping, always handle Stoneware Tableware with care, especially when stacking. Avoid dropping or knocking it against hard surfaces, and store it in a safe place to reduce the risk of accidental damage. Q: Can I use Stoneware Tableware directly from the oven to the table, or do I need to let it cool first? A: Stoneware Tableware can generally go directly from the oven to the table, thanks to its excellent heat retention properties. However, always ensure the item is oven-safe and avoid drastic temperature changes, which can cause it to crack.
